Best pet bed for Beagle. When it comes to choosing the best pet bed for a Beagle, there are a few factors to consider such as the size, age, and sleeping habits of your dog. Here are some options that may suit your Beagle:

  1. Donut bed: Beagles love to curl up, and a donut-shaped bed can be an excellent option. This type of bed provides a soft, comfortable place for your Beagle to rest and provides support for their head and neck.
  2. Orthopedic bed: If your Beagle is older or has joint issues, an orthopedic bed may be the best choice. These beds provide extra support and comfort for dogs with arthritis or other joint problems.
  3. Washable bed: Beagles can be prone to allergies, so a washable bed may be a good option. These beds have removable covers that can be easily washed, which can help reduce the risk of allergens.
  4. Raised bed: Beagles can be prone to overheating, and a raised bed can be a good option to help keep them cool. This type of bed is designed to keep your dog off the ground, which can help them stay cooler in warm weather.
  5. Cosy cave bed: Some Beagles like to burrow and hide, so a cosy cave bed can be a great option. This type of bed has a cover that can be pulled over your dog, providing a sense of security and warmth.

Overall, the best pet bed for your Beagle will depend on their specific needs and preferences. Consider the size of your Beagle, their sleeping habits, and any health issues they may have when choosing a bed. With a little attention and care, you can create a comfortable sleeping environment that your Beagle will love.

Beagle sleeping preferences

Beagles, like all dogs, have their own individual sleeping preferences, but there are some common patterns and behaviours that many Beagles share when it comes to sleeping. Here are a few things to keep in mind when it comes to a Beagle’s sleeping preferences:

  1. Beagles like to be comfortable: Beagles are known for being relatively low-maintenance when it comes to their grooming and appearance, but they do appreciate comfort when it comes to sleeping. They tend to prefer soft, comfortable surfaces to sleep on, and they may be more likely to seek out cozy, cushioned spots rather than hard surfaces like the floor.
  2. Beagles like to be warm: Beagles have a short, dense coat that provides some insulation, but they are still more sensitive to changes in temperature than some other breeds. They may prefer to sleep in warm spots, such as on a heated bed or in a sunny patch of the house.
  3. Beagles like to be close to their owners: Beagles are generally quite social and affectionate, and they often enjoy being close to their owners. They may prefer to sleep in the same room as their owners or to sleep on their owners’ beds or furniture.
  4. Beagles like routine: Like many dogs, Beagles tend to thrive on routine and predictability. They may prefer to sleep in the same spot every night, and they may be more likely to settle down and sleep well if they have a consistent bedtime routine.
  5. Beagles like to sleep a lot: Beagles are generally a fairly laid-back breed, and they tend to spend a lot of time sleeping. Depending on their age and activity level, they may need up to 14 hours of sleep per day. It’s important to provide them with a comfortable, safe sleeping space where they can rest and recharge.

Ultimately, the best way to figure out your Beagle’s sleeping preferences is to observe them closely and see what they seem to enjoy. Pay attention to where they like to sleep, what kind of surfaces or bedding they prefer, and how they behave when they are settling down to sleep. With a little attention and care, you can create a sleeping environment that is comfortable, safe, and satisfying for your Beagle.

What to Consider When Choosing a Pet Bed for Your Labrador Retriever

Before purchasing a pet bed for your Labrador Retriever, there are several factors you should consider. Here are some of the most important ones:

Size Matters

Labrador Retrievers are medium to large-sized dogs, so it’s essential to choose a bed that fits their size. A bed that is too small can be uncomfortable, while a bed that is too large can make your pet feel insecure. As a general rule, the bed should be large enough for your pet to stretch out comfortably but not so large that they get lost in it.

Support and Comfort

Just like humans, dogs also need support and comfort while sleeping. Choose a pet bed that offers good support for your Labrador’s joints and spine. Memory foam or orthopedic beds are an excellent choice for older dogs or those with joint problems. However, if your Labrador is still young and healthy, a simple foam bed will suffice.

Durability and Easy to Clean

Labrador Retrievers are active and playful dogs, which means their beds can take a beating. Therefore, it’s important to choose a bed that is durable and can withstand your pet’s energy. Look for beds made with high-quality materials such as chew-resistant fabrics or sturdy frames. Also, make sure the bed is easy to clean as Labradors can be messy.

When it comes to choosing the best pet bed for a Rhodesian Ridgeback, there are several factors to consider, such as the size of the bed, the material, and the level of support it provides. Here are some options that may be suitable for a Rhodesian Ridgeback:

  1. Large Dog Bed – Rhodesian Ridgebacks are a large-sized breed, so a large-sized bed will give them enough space to stretch out and move around comfortably. Make sure to choose a bed that is the right size for your pet, with enough room for them to lie down in their natural position.
  2. Orthopedic Dog Bed – Like many larger breeds, Rhodesian Ridgebacks are prone to joint problems as they age, so an orthopedic bed that can provide extra support and cushioning for their joints may be a good option. Look for one with memory foam or supportive padding to help alleviate their discomfort.
  3. Raised Dog Bed – Rhodesian Ridgebacks have a short coat and can overheat easily, so a raised bed that allows for better air circulation can be a good option to keep them cool and comfortable. Raised beds are also beneficial for senior dogs with mobility issues.
  4. Cosy Dog Bed – Rhodesian Ridgebacks are known for their sweet and affectionate personalities, so a cozy bed may be a good option. Look for a bed with a soft, plush material that can make them feel comfortable and secure.
  5. Washable Dog Bed – Rhodesian Ridgebacks can be messy dogs, so a washable bed can make cleaning up after them much easier. Look for a bed with a removable cover that can be washed in the washing machine.

Ultimately, the best pet bed for a Rhodesian Ridgeback will depend on their individual preferences and needs. It’s important to choose a bed that is comfortable, supportive, and durable to ensure that your pet gets the rest they need to stay healthy and happy.

A dog cave bed is a cosy and comfortable type of dog bed that provides a sense of security and privacy for your furry friend. It’s also known as a hooded or covered dog bed, as it features a covered design that allows your dog to nestle inside and feel protected.

Dog cave beds come in various sizes, shapes, and materials, but they typically consist of a soft and plush interior with a removable and washable cover. Some cave beds have a removable cushion for added comfort, while others have a built-in pillow or blanket for extra warmth.

To choose the right dog cave bed for your pup, consider their size, sleeping style, and personal preferences. Make sure the bed is large enough for them to stretch out comfortably, but not too big that they won’t feel cosy and snug inside. You’ll also want to consider the material and filling of the bed, as some dogs may have allergies or prefer a certain texture.

When it comes to cleaning a dog cave bed, it’s important to follow the care instructions provided by the manufacturer. Most dog cave beds have removable covers that can be machine washed and dried, while the foam or cushion inside should be spot cleaned or air dried. Always make sure the bed is completely dry before allowing your dog to use it again to prevent the growth of mould and bacteria.

How to clean foam dog bed

Get Rid of Nasty Odours and Bacteria from Your Dog’s Foam Bed with These Easy Steps!

Here are the steps to clean a foam dog bed:

  1. Remove any loose debris from the bed, such as pet hair, using a vacuum cleaner or a lint roller.
  2. Blot up any excess moisture or urine with a clean cloth or paper towels. You can also use a handheld vacuum or a wet/dry vacuum to remove any moisture or debris from the foam.
  3. Spot clean any stains or soiled areas with a mixture of mild detergent and water. Gently rub the mixture onto the affected area with a soft-bristled brush or sponge, being careful not to apply too much pressure or saturate the foam. Rinse with clean water and blot dry with a clean cloth or paper towels.
  4. For tougher stains or odours, you can use a mixture of one part white vinegar and two parts water. Spray the solution onto the affected area and let it sit for 5-10 minutes. Blot up any excess moisture with a clean cloth or paper towels, and then rinse with clean water. Let the foam air dry completely.
  5. To deodorize the foam dog bed, you can sprinkle baking soda over the entire surface of the foam, and then let it sit for several hours or overnight. Vacuum up the baking soda with a handheld vacuum or attachment.
  6. If the foam dog bed has a removable cover, follow the care instructions on the label for cleaning the cover separately. Be sure to remove any solid waste or excess moisture from the foam bed before putting the cover back on.
  7. Once the foam dog bed is clean and dry, you can fluff it up by shaking it or fluffing it with your hands to restore its shape and support.

It’s important to note that foam dog beds may take longer to dry than other types of dog beds, so be sure to allow ample time for the foam to air dry completely before using it again.

How to clean urine from foam dog bed

Urine stains no more: Learn how to clean foam dog bed in just a few steps!

Cleaning urine from a foam dog bed can be a bit of a challenge, but here are some steps you can follow:

  1. Remove any solid waste from the bed using paper towels or a plastic scraper.
  2. Blot up as much of the urine as possible using paper towels or a clean cloth. Press down firmly on the area to absorb as much moisture as possible.
  3. Mix a solution of one part white vinegar and one part water in a spray bottle.
  4. Spray the solution onto the urine stain and let it sit for 5-10 minutes.
  5. Blot the area again with paper towels or a clean cloth to absorb the vinegar solution and any remaining moisture.
  6. If the urine stain and odour persist, you can sprinkle baking soda over the affected area and let it sit for several hours or overnight. Then vacuum up the baking soda with a handheld vacuum or attachment.
  7. To finish, let the foam dog bed air dry completely in a well-ventilated area, preferably outdoors in the sunlight. Avoid using a dryer or a hair dryer as heat can damage the foam material.

Repeat the process if necessary until the urine stain and odour are completely gone. It’s also a good idea to use a waterproof mattress protector or a dog bed cover in the future to prevent any accidents from soaking into the foam.

Can you wash foam in a washing machine?

It is generally not recommended to wash foam in a washing machine as it can damage the foam material and cause it to lose its shape and support. The agitation of the washing machine can also cause the foam to break apart and become lumpy.

However, some foam products, such as foam pillows or foam cushions, may have removable covers that can be machine washed according to the care instructions. If the foam dog bed has a removable cover that is machine washable, you can wash and dry the cover separately, but be sure to remove any solid waste or excess moisture from the foam bed before putting the cover back on.

If the foam dog bed itself is heavily soiled, you may want to consider spot cleaning it with a mild detergent and water, and then letting it air dry completely in a well-ventilated area. Alternatively, you can hire a professional upholstery cleaner who has experience with cleaning foam products.

Can you put a foam dog bed in the dryer?

It is not recommended to put a foam dog bed in the dryer as the heat can damage the foam material and cause it to lose its shape and support. Additionally, the high temperature in the dryer can cause any remaining urine or odour to set in, making it even more difficult to remove.

Instead, it is best to let the foam dog bed air dry completely in a well-ventilated area, preferably outdoors in the sunlight. To speed up the drying process, you can use a fan or a dehumidifier to circulate air and reduce moisture.

If the foam dog bed has a removable cover that is machine washable, you can wash and dry the cover separately according to the care instructions. However, be sure to remove any solid waste or excess moisture from the foam bed before putting the cover back on.

How to wash a dog bed without removable cover

Dirty dog bed? No problem! Learn how to wash your dog’s bed without a removable cover!

Washing a dog bed without a removable cover can be a bit more challenging, but it is still possible to do a thorough cleaning. Here’s how:

  1. Start by removing any loose debris, pet hair, and large dirt particles from the bed. You can use a vacuum cleaner or a lint roller to remove any loose debris.
  2. Fill a bathtub or large sink with warm water and add a pet-safe detergent to the water. Mix the detergent well to ensure it is evenly distributed in the water.
  3. Place the dog bed in the bathtub or sink and use a clean cloth or a soft-bristled brush to gently scrub the bed. Pay extra attention to any soiled areas or stains.
  4. Once you’ve scrubbed the bed thoroughly, drain the soapy water and refill the bathtub or sink with clean, warm water. Rinse the bed well to remove any remaining soap residue.
  5. Squeeze as much excess water out of the bed as possible and then blot it with a clean towel to help remove any additional moisture.
  6. Finally, place the bed in a well-ventilated area to air dry completely. You may want to flip the bed over periodically to ensure it dries evenly on all sides.

It’s important to note that washing a dog bed without a removable cover can be more time-consuming than washing a bed with a removable cover. However, it’s still important to keep your dog’s bed clean and free from dirt, bacteria, and other contaminants to help ensure your dog stays healthy and comfortable.

Washing dog bed with vinegar and baking soda

Revive Your Dog’s Bed with This Simple Cleaning Hack

Using vinegar and baking soda can be an effective and natural way to clean and deodorize your dog’s bed. Here’s how to do it:

  1. First, remove any loose debris or pet hair from the bed by shaking it out or using a vacuum cleaner.
  2. Mix 1 cup of white vinegar with 1 cup of water in a spray bottle. Spray the mixture over the entire surface of the bed, making sure to saturate it well.
  3. Sprinkle baking soda over the bed, focusing on any areas with visible stains or odours.
  4. Allow the vinegar and baking soda to sit on the bed for at least 30 minutes or up to an hour to help break down any dirt, stains, and odours.
  5. After the mixture has had time to sit, use a scrub brush or a clean cloth to work the baking soda into the bed, focusing on any stains or soiled areas.
  6. Once the bed has been thoroughly scrubbed, rinse it well with water to remove any remaining vinegar and baking soda.
  7. Finally, let the bed air dry completely before allowing your dog to use it again.

It’s important to note that while vinegar and baking soda are generally safe for use on dog beds, it’s always a good idea to test any cleaning method on a small, inconspicuous area of the bed first to make sure it doesn’t cause any damage or discoloration.

Additionally, some materials may not be suitable for this cleaning method, so be sure to check the care instructions that came with the bed before using vinegar and baking soda.

10 Reasons why it is important to keep your dog bed clean

The Shocking Truth About Dirty Dog Beds – Must Read!

Keeping your dog’s bed clean is important for several reasons. Here are 10 reasons why you should make sure your dog’s bed is clean and well-maintained:

  1. Health: A dirty bed can be a breeding ground for bacteria, mould, and other harmful microorganisms that can cause your dog to get sick.
  2. Allergies: A dirty bed can cause allergies in dogs, especially if they have sensitive skin or respiratory issues.
  3. Comfort: A clean bed is more comfortable for your dog to sleep in, and it can help them get a better night’s rest.
  4. Odour: A dirty bed can start to smell, making your home smell bad and unpleasant.
  5. Fleas and ticks: A dirty bed can attract fleas and ticks, which can then infest your home and your dog.
  6. Shedding: A dirty bed can cause your dog to shed more than usual, leading to more pet hair on your floors and furniture.
  7. Stains: A dirty bed can cause stains, which can be difficult or impossible to remove over time.
  8. Durability: A clean bed can last longer than a dirty one since dirt, oils, and bacteria can weaken the bed’s materials over time.
  9. Appearance: A clean bed looks better and is more aesthetically pleasing than a dirty, stained bed.
  10. Preventing Reinfection: If your dog has recently recovered from an illness, keeping the bed clean and sanitized will help prevent a re-infection.

In conclusion, keeping your dog’s bed clean is essential to their health, comfort, and overall well-being.

A clean bed can help prevent the spread of harmful bacteria and viruses, reduce the risk of allergies, and provide a more comfortable and odor-free environment for your dog.

A clean bed can also prevent the infestation of fleas and ticks, reduce shedding, prevent stains, and prolong the bed’s lifespan.

By taking the time to regularly clean your dog’s bed, you can ensure that your furry friend has a safe, healthy, and comfortable place to rest and sleep.
